Перейти к основному содержимому

baselines

Description

Настраивает функциональность базовых линий в диаграмме Ганта

baselines: BaselineConfig | boolean

Example

gantt.config.baselines = {
datastore: "baselines",
render_mode: false,
dataprocessor_baselines: false,
row_height: 16,
bar_height: 8
};
gantt.init("gantt_here");

Details

Этот конфиг определяет, как базовые линии обрабатываются и отображаются в диаграмме Ганта. Он может быть задан как объект для настройки отображения или как булево значение для включения или отключения функции. Объект конфигурации содержит следующие свойства:

  • datastore - (string) - имя datastore, используемого для хранения записей базовых линий. Для смежного функционала смотрите метод getDatastore.
  • render_mode - (boolean | string) - определяет, как отображаются базовые линии:
  • false - базовые линии не отображаются.
  • "taskRow" - базовые линии отображаются в той же строке, что и задача.
  • "separateRow" - базовые линии отображаются в отдельной подстроке, увеличивая высоту строки задач.
  • "individualRow" - каждая базовая линия отображается в своей собственной подстроке под задачей.
  • dataprocessor_baselines - (boolean) - указывает, следует ли обновления базовых линий вызывать DataProcessor как отдельные записи.
  • row_height - (number) - определяет высоту подстроки для базовых линий, применяется только когда render_mode установлен в значение "separateRow" или "individualRow".
  • bar_height - (number) - задаёт высоту полосы базовой линии.

Change log

  • добавлено в v9.0
Need help?
Got a question about the documentation? Reach out to our technical support team for help and guidance. For custom component solutions, visit the Services page.